I recently bought a copy of Halo PC and downloaded Halo Custom Edition for multiplayer, but I have been having an issue since I first installed the game. Whenever I click on "Multiplayer" on the main menu, the game immediately crashes and displays an error message that says "Gathering Exception Data." Both Halo PC and Halo CE are up to date and the campaign works fine. Just the multiplayer is having issues. I completely uninstalled and reinstalled both games and patched them but that didn't help me.
I use a machine running Windows 8.1 with an AMD FX 4300, a Radeon HD 7770 2GDR5 by Asus and 8 GB of G Skill Sniper series RAM running at 1866 MHz.
I would really appreciate it if someone could help me with this issue.
